Pros and Cons of Financing a New HVAC System

HVAC systems have a very important role in homes, since they help maintain a comfortable indoor environment during all seasons of the year. The term HVAC often gets associated with temperature, but these systems also control other important aspects like ventilation and air humidity. However, this comfort has a cost: heating and cooling represent 51% of home energy consumption, according to the U.S. Energy Information Administration. Replacing Your Old AC Unit That Takes R-22 Refrigerants

You might not have heard that in January of this year, the Environmental Protection Agency moved ahead with its next step in phasing out hydrochlorofluorocarbons (HCFCs). They have banned the import and remaining production of HCFC-22 and HCFC-142b. These chemicals, also called R-22s, are known to deplete the ozone layer leaving the Earth less protected from the sun’s ultraviolet radiation.
